
Paperback
Published 04 May 2017
- $21.13
5 results
Paperback
Published 04 May 2017
$1.56off
Paperback
Published 15 May 1998
Save $1.56
Paperback
Published 18 Jun 1998
Paperback
Published 17 Jun 1997
Hardback
Published 09 May 1997